Looking for help IDing this dino strain. It doesn't seem to be toxic as I have not lost any snails and it is sometimes on coral long term without causing death
APC_0070.jpg
 
Whatever it is, it seems to be nontoxic. The only time it seems to tick coral off is if it blocks light too long. I don't see any dead snails. I was watching a turbo graze on it last night and he's healthy as ever.


It's the tip of the cell structure that throws me off for ID
